In a recently published article, scientists in the United States conducted a study "to examine the associations between postmortem Alzheimer disease (AD) neuropathology and autopsy-verified cardiovascular disease."
M.S. Beeri and colleagues at Mount Sinai School of Medicine in New York examined" 99 subjects (mean age at death=87.6; SD=8.7) from the Mount Sinai School of Medicine Department of Psychiatry Brain Bank who were devoid of cerebrovascular disease-associated lesions or of non-AD-related neuropathology.
